As its much newer sequel struggles, the 13-year-old Payday 2 is getting a 'massive engine upgrade' that improves performance and cuts the install size in half
Starbreeze Studios and Sidetrack Games are releasing a major engine upgrade for the 13-year-old game Payday 2. This update will port the game to a 64-bit architecture, upgrade to DirectX 11 rendering, and reduce the install size by more than half, improving performance and stability. A public beta for the engine overhaul is scheduled to begin on June 30.
